Help with OEM Wheel vs. Replica
 
Hi all,
I'm looking at buying some 19" multi spoke wheels for my C63 and found a set online for a great price but I'm thinking it might be too good to be true. Just from these pictures are there anyways of telling OEM vs replicas?
Size and offset seems to be right. Front 19x8 45 and Rear 19x9 54

That's a terribly irrelevant picture. The stamped AMG plate is on the inside of the lip for multispokes on w204. The logo is also indented.

real ones:

These are ebay replicas. Notice how the logo plate is blank?

I have a different set of ebay multispoke replicas and the AMG logo is an added on plate, not an indented stamp. They also say made in China on the inside. Had them on my car for years with no issues too.

OP check to see if they say made in Germany on the inside with the part numbers. Your pictures aren't that great, but the indented logo is a good sign they are OEM.
